  • Patent number: 11882936
    Abstract: A system for fastening panels at 90-degree angles and at 180-degree angles is provided comprising a frame hammer assembly attached proximate a first edge of a first panel and a frame dowel pin assembly attached proximate a second edge of a second panel. At least one dowel pin protrudes from the dowel pin assembly, the at least one pin inserted into an alignment hole in the frame hammer assembly upon placement of the first edge against the second edge and alignment of the assemblies. A rotatable hammer attached to the hammer assembly, the hammer attached, after rotation, to the dowel pin assembly. A hammer magnet is attached to the hammer and one of a frame magnet and a frame steel plate attached to the dowel pin assembly, the hammer magnet and the one of the frame magnet and frame steel plate attracting and contacting after rotation.

  • Publication number: 20230105194
    Abstract: A system for fastening panels in a perpendicular manner is provided. The system comprises a semicircular base frame attached in a recessed manner into an edge area of a first panel, a similarly shaped semicircular top frame fastened atop the base frame, and a dial magnet assembly resident in the top frame. The system also comprises a slider mount assembly with an embedded magnet and attached proximate an edge of a second panel that receives insertion into a cavity created by the fastening of the top frame to the base frame. The slider mount assembly also receives attraction to the top frame based on a turning action of the dial magnet assembly in a first direction and binds to the fastened top frame and base frame based on the received attraction. The binding of the slider mount assembly to the fastened frames binds the two panels in a perpendicular manner.

  • Patent number: 11497313
    Abstract: A number of magnetically assisted latch mechanisms are presented, where the latching and unlatching action is done with reduced user effort, therefore promoting speed and efficiency without sacrificing the strength of the bond of the connected components. The latching mechanisms are designed to secure panels or other similar small and large mostly flat components. The latching method is done by a rotating component that takes all the separating load once rotated into the locked position. The rotatable lock, or hammer, is also locked itself into position to prevent accidental movement by the hammer.

  • Patent number: 10428541
    Abstract: A shelter includes: at least two side walls; a back wall; and a roof, wherein the side walls, the back wall, and the roof comprise a material that is weatherproof and insulated, and wherein the shelter is collapsible, detachable, and portable. The shelter can also include at least two side walls, wherein an upper end of the at least two side walls conjoin to form a roof. The shelter is lightweight, detachable, and portable. The shelter can be weatherproof and insulated for permanently or temporarily housing people and/or animals. The shelter can be transported to a desired location and assembled on-site with ease. When the use of the shelter is no longer desired, the shelter can be quickly disassembled and transported to another location.
